The short version

Old Brownsboro Place is significantly wealthier than the US average, with a median household income of $76,832. Population has declined 12% since 2000. 63%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, well above the national rate of 20%. Median home value is $144,700. With a median age of 41.7, the population is older than the US median of 33.0. Households here earn about 241% more than the Kentucky median.
